"In Focus: The Landscape" at The Getty Center

This exhibition, drawn exclusively from the Getty Museum's collection, brings together the work of more than 25 innovative photographers who have left their mark on the history of the genre. Representing key moments in the history of photography, the photographs in this exhibition are presented roughly chronologically to make the progression of aesthetic and technical developments apparent. August 26, 2008 thru January 11, 2009. More information.

Brett Abbott, associate curator, department of photographs, leads a gallery talk on the exhibition. Meet under the stairs in the Museum Entrance Hall. Free; no reservations required. Wednesday, October 8, 2008, 2:30 p.m. Getty Center, Museum galleries
